working with transfer function, overflow error

I am working with a transfer function that modelates a MIMO system of 15 inputs and 15 outputs. I have to perform the following operation:
H2=H/(A*H+B);
where H is the transfer function of the original system, A and B are scalar matrix of dimensions 15x15 and H2 is the transfer function that I want to obtain.
I have tried the command:
Hin=A*H+B;
H2=H/Hin;
but I obtain the following message: 'Unable to convert the model to a transfer function because of overflow'

I note this post is rather old. I trust you've long since resolved the issue. In the off-chance.. in this situation I would usually look to obtain a minimal realisation with a suitable tolerance prior to the manipulation of H
i.e.
> minreal(H,tolerance)
In general, numeric LTI models are not ideal where accuracy is concerned. If poss a ss approach would be preferable
